Variant summary
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.
The NM_014141.6(CNTNAP2):c.2239G>A(p.Ala747Thr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000083 in 1,613,652 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A747V) has been classified as Uncertain significance.

Cortical dysplasia-focal epilepsy syndrome Uncertain:1
This sequence change replaces alanine, which is neutral and non-polar, with threonine, which is neutral and polar, at codon 747 of the CNTNAP2 protein (p.Ala747Thr). This variant is present in population databases (rs150530671, gnomAD 0.03%). This variant has not been reported in the literature in individuals affected with CNTNAP2-related conditions. ClinVar contains an entry for this variant (Variation ID: 205261).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be disruptive.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
Inborn genetic diseases Uncertain:1
The c.2239G>A (p.A747T) alteration is located in exon 14 (coding exon 14) of the CNTNAP2 gene. This alteration results from a G to A substitution at nucleotide position 2239, causing the alanine (A) at amino acid position 747 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
